Tetragon Financial Group Limited Annual General Meeting 
 
LONDON, Dec. 17, 2018 /PRNewswire/ -- 
 
Annual General Meeting: 
 
Tetragon's annual general meeting will be held on 31 December 2018.  The Notice 
of General Meeting may be found at the following link: https:// 
www.tetragoninv.com/2018 AGM Notice.  One of the purposes of the annual general 
meeting is to propose that each of the following individuals be appointed as a 
director of Tetragon: 
 
Mr. Deron J. Haley - Independent Director 
Mr. Steven W. Hart - Independent Director 
Mr. David C. O'Leary - Independent Director 
Mr. Reade E. Griffith 
Mr. Paddy G. G. Dear 
 
Note that only the owner of Tetragon's voting shares will be entitled to vote 
at the annual general meeting.  The biographies of each of the proposed 
Independent Directors are set forth below. 
 
Paddy Dear, a Co-Founder of Tetragon's investment manager and a member of 
Tetragon's Board of Directors, said, "We would like to thank Rupert Dorey, 
David Jeffreys and Bud Rogers for their service to the company.  Rupert and 
David have been Independent Directors since Tetragon's launch as an open-ended 
fund in 2005, continuing in their role through the company's initial public 
offering in 2007.  Bud advised Tetragon from its IPO until his retirement from 
the Corporate Department of Cravath, Swaine & Moore LLP in December 2015, 
following which he joined as an Independent Director.  During their tenure, 
Tetragon has demonstrably achieved its investment objective of generating 
distributable income and capital appreciation by returning approximately 
U.S.$1.25 billion to its shareholders through dividends and share buybacks - 
nearly as much as the company's net asset value at the time of its IPO - and 
growing its NAV to approximately U.S.$2.1 billion." 
 
Stephen Prince, the Head of TFG Asset Management, said, "We are excited about 
the backgrounds and experience of the proposed Independent Directors and the 
expected overall composition of the Board of Directors.  With extensive private 
equity and asset management expertise as well as considerable operational and 
administrative experience, we believe that Tetragon's new Independent Directors 
will be able to effectively oversee the management of the business while 
providing valuable strategic guidance as Tetragon continues to diversify its 
alternative asset portfolio and looks to continue to grow TFG Asset Management 
- as Tetragon's diversified alternative asset management business - with a view 
to a possible initial public offering and listing of its shares." 
 
Rupert Dorey, speaking on behalf of the Independent Directors, said, "We have 
enjoyed the opportunity of sitting on Tetragon's Board of Directors and 
working with Tetragon's investment manager to grow and strengthen the 
business over the years.  We wish the proposed directors the best as they work 
with Tetragon in the next phase of its growth." 
 
Mr. Deron J. Haley.  Mr. Haley, also known as D.J., is a founding Partner and 
Chief Operating Officer at Durational Capital Management, LP, a New York-based 
private equity firm that specializes in consumer buy-outs.  Prior to Durational 
Capital Management, Mr. Haley was the Chief Operating Officer of Hound 
Partners, LLC, a New York-based global equity fund.  Prior thereto, he was a 
senior executive of Ziff Brothers Investments, LLC, a global, single-family 
office that invested directly in private and public equities, fixed income, 
global-macro, and commodities, and led firm-wide operational and management 
initiatives.  Mr. Haley began his finance career as an equity research analyst, 
and later a registered trader before taking on senior managerial roles.  Prior 
to finance, Mr. Haley served five years active duty in the United States Navy. 
 He is a founding Director of the Navy SEAL Foundation and is a member of the 
Governance and Investment Committees.  Mr. Haley is a Director of Ibis Tek, 
Inc, a small-business defense contractor, and also sits on the Investment 
Committee of The Heinz Endowments.  Mr. Haley recently served as an independent 
director on the Boards of Directors of several funds managed by TFG Asset 
Management.  He holds a B.S. degree in Mechanical Engineering from Carnegie 
Mellon University in Pittsburgh and a M.B.A. degree from Harvard Business 
School. 
 
Mr. Steven W. Hart.   Mr. Hart serves as president of Hart Capital LLC, which 
he founded in 1998 as a family office to invest in a diversified portfolio of 
assets with a strong education industry focus.  He also co-founded Florian 
Education Investors LLC in May 2013, which now includes an ACCSC accredited 
postsecondary vocational education company offering on ground and online 
diploma and degree programs to the allied health community.  Mr. Hart was the 
co-owner (1999-2010) and member of the Board of Directors (1999-2007) of 
Lincoln Educational Services Corporation.  From 1983 to 1997, he was co-founder 
of a family-owned conglomerate where he acquired and managed manufacturing and 
distribution companies involved in automotive, printing, apparel and industrial 
textiles, electronics, synthetic foam, and home furnishing industries.  Mr. 
Hart served as chairman of the State of Connecticut Investment Advisory Council 
from 1995 to 2003, which oversees the State of Connecticut Retirement Plans and 
Trust Funds, and, as a trustee (1996-2003), and chairman (2003) of the Stanford 
University Graduate School of Business Endowment Trust. He also served as a 
member of Golden Seeds, an angel stage investment firm focused on empowerment 
of women entrepreneurs.  Since 2011, Mr. Hart has been a member of the Boards 
of Directors of several funds connected with Blue Harbour Group, L.P., a hedge 
fund based in Greenwich, Connecticut.  He earned an M.B.A. degree from Stanford 
University Graduate School of Business and a B.A. degree in mathematics and 
economics from Wesleyan University. 
 
Mr. David C. O'Leary.  Mr. O'Leary retired from State Street Corporation in 
Boston, Massachusetts in 2012, where he was Executive Vice President - Chief 
Administrative Officer (2010-2012) and Executive Vice President - Global Head 
of Human Resources (2005-2010).  At State Street, he managed a global team of 
325 staff across 15 countries, was a member of its 10-person Operating Group 
and Management Committee, reporting directly to its Chief Executive Officer. 
From 1985 to 2004, Mr. O'Leary was at Credit Suisse First Boston, serving as 
Managing Director, Global Head of Human Resources from 1988 to 2003, where he 
managed a global team of 250 staff in 13 countries responsible for all aspects 
of Human Resources in the Americas, Europe, and Asia.  Mr. O'Leary began his 
career in financial services at Merrill Lynch & Company in New York, where he 
was Vice President - Executive Compensation from 1981 to 1985.  He earned a 
M.B.A. degree from the University of Massachusetts, where he graduated first in 
his class, a M.S. degree from the State University of New York and a B.S. 
degree from Union College. 
 
Group Structure: 
 
As previously announced, Tetragon Financial Group Master Fund Limited, through 
which Tetragon has historically invested substantially all its capital, is 
expected to be amalgamated with Tetragon, the listed parent company, effective 
as of 31 December 2018.  The amalgamated company will continue as Tetragon 
Financial Group Limited.  The appointment of the directors of Tetragon at the 
31 December 2018 annual general meeting will be effective upon the 
amalgamation. 
 
About Tetragon: 
 
Tetragon is a closed-ended investment company that invests in a broad range of 
assets, including bank loans, real estate, equities, credit, convertible bonds, 
private equity, infrastructure and TFG Asset Management, a diversified 
alternative asset management business.  Where appropriate, through TFG Asset 
Management, Tetragon seeks to own all, or a portion, of asset management 
companies with which it invests in order to enhance the returns achieved on its 
capital.  Tetragon's investment objective is to generate distributable income 
and capital appreciation. It aims to provide stable returns to investors across 
various credit, equity, interest rate, inflation and real estate cycles. The 
company is traded on Euronext in Amsterdam N.V. and on the Specialist Fund 
Segment of the main market of the London Stock Exchange. For more information 
please visit the company's website at www.tetragoninv.com.
